Steps
- 1
In a small mixing bowl, add cacao powder, salt, maple syrup/honey. Stir and mix to combine.
- 2
Add a little non-dairy milk little by little until a paste forms. Then add the remaining milk and stir smooth.
- 3
Add in chia seeds little by little while stirring to combine.
- 4
Separate into mini bowls of choice then cling wrap and chill over night. (Minimum 3 hours until it’s achieved pudding-like consistency)
- 5
Serve chilled with desired toppings e.g fruits, whip cream, granola. Can be kept in the fridge for up to 4-5 days, though best when fresh.
